lrvin G. Isner

I was born on April 27, 1922 in Elkins, West Virginia. I graduated from Elkins High School in the Class of 1939. I worked for Mason Lumber Company from May 1940 to November 1942. I married Guinevere D. Kelly on September 23, 1942 at Oakland, Maryland. I enlisted in the U.S. Navy on November II, 1942 at Charleston, West Virginia. I underwent training at USNTS, Great Lakes, Illinois; 16 weeks of Radio/School at NTSCH at the University of Wisconsin, Madison, Wisconsin; and Radio School in San Francisco, California. I boarded the U.S.S. Nassau on June 3, 1943. I held the ratings of AS, S2C, SIC, RM3C, RM2C (T), and RMIC (T).

My memorable events are the 1st Invasion of the Gilbert Islands and the 2nd Invasion of the Marshall Islands. Memorable times were in the Radio Room keeping communications going.

After 27 months aboard the U.S.S. Nassau, I departed on December 12, 1945, and was Discharged on September 28th at Bainbridge, Maryland.

Our daughter was born in 1946 and our son in 1950. We have four grand children and one great-grandson.

Presently, I am retired after 48 years at Elkins Monumental Works. From May of 1967 to March of 1993, I was co-owner of Elkins Monumental Works.
